4-5:30 PM – Live music by Bahuru and Baduku | Bahuru and Baduku are Zimbabwean-style marimba bands comprised of middle and high school-age members of the Tri Cities Steel Band Association (TCSBA). TCSBA is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ization based in Richland, Washington that promotes world music through education and music performance.
